FARGO — Taking pictures of children as they head off to their first day of school has been a tradition for quite some time. Matt Niemeyer, a school resource officer with the Fargo Police Department, said photos showing what school the child attends, their bus stop, even something as small as a school logo or name can potentially show strangers where the child is five days out of the week. "All of these things, that age of public information can be used to gain more information and potentially find them. And parents should avoid posting any personal information about the child online.
